What Is Handwriting OCR?

Handwriting OCR (Optical Character Recognition) is an advanced AI-powered technology that extracts handwritten characters from scanned images or photographs and converts them into machine-readable, editable text.

How Handwriting-to-Text Conversion Works

Below is the complete technical workflow used by leading OCR platforms:

1. Image Capture

The process begins with either:

  • A flatbed scanner (recommended 300–600 DPI)

  • A smartphone camera with stabilization

2. Image Preprocessing

The software automatically:

  • Removes background noise

  • Adjusts brightness and contrast

  • Corrects skew and distortion

  • Enhances text edges

3. Segmentation

The system identifies:

  • Lines

  • Words

  • Individual characters

4. Recognition Engine

Deep learning models analyze stroke patterns and contextual clues to determine the correct characters.

5. Post-Processing

Spelling correction and grammar modeling refine the extracted text.

Step-by-Step: How to Convert Handwriting to Text with Maximum Accuracy

Step 1: Capture a High-Quality Image

  • Use at least 300 DPI resolution

  • Avoid shadows and glare

  • Ensure even lighting

  • Keep the page flat

Step 2: Clean the Image

Before running OCR:

  • Crop unnecessary margins

  • Increase contrast

  • Convert to grayscale

  • Straighten tilted pages

Step 3: Select Handwriting OCR Mode

Many platforms provide separate modes for:

  • Printed text

  • Handwriting

  • Mixed content

Always choose the dedicated handwriting option.

Step 4: Choose the Correct Language

Misidentified languages reduce recognition accuracy significantly.

Step 5: Proofread and Export

Always review:

  • Names

  • Technical terminology

  • Symbols

  • Mathematical formulas

Export to your required format (DOCX, TXT, searchable PDF).


Accuracy Factors That Influence Handwriting Recognition

To maximize OCR performance:

Writing Style

  • Clear block letters outperform decorative cursive.

Ink Contrast

  • Dark ink on white paper improves recognition.

Line Spacing

  • Adequate spacing prevents segmentation errors.

Paper Quality

  • Avoid textured or patterned backgrounds.

Image Resolution

  • A minimum of 300 DPI is recommended.

Security and Data Protection in OCR Conversion

When handling confidential documents:

  • Prefer desktop OCR for local processing

  • Use encrypted storage

  • Implement restricted user permissions

  • Maintain compliance with regulatory frameworks

Cloud-based tools should provide:

  • End-to-end encryption

  • Clear data retention policies

  • Secure upload protocols
